Are people in Wayland older or younger than people in Reading?
- The Median Age in Wayland is 0.4 years older than in Reading.

Are housing costs cheaper in Wayland or Reading?
- Wayland housing costs are 23.2% more expensive than Reading hous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Wayland or Reading?
- The average commute for residents of Wayland is 2.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Reading.
